Tour of Quito and Visit the Teleferico: "Quito from the Sky"

LTE-QDT002: City Tour (Teleférico)



A great way to hit the highlights of Quito; you will visit the historical center, the charismatic Guápulo, and get a terrific view of the city from the city’s highest look-out point. You will enjoy historic plazas, buildings, and churches that display a fascinating mixture of Spanish and indigenous architecture.

 

 

Itinerary

We will visit the charming Guápulo, located on the western hillside of Quito, and in the historical centre we will enjoy colonial architecture, legends, and learn about the Inca and pre-Inca importance of the area. On Plaza San Francisco, a trade spot long before the arrival of the Spaniards, we will visit the Tianguez Art Gallery.

We may head up to the Panecillo (“winged virgin”) look out, or head even higher up on the slopes of the Pichincha Volcano with help of an aerial cableway.

Highlights

Guápulo The charming little area Guápulo is located on the western hillside of Quito. Enjoy cobble stone streets, cosy little restaurants and cafes, and the famous church of Guápulo

Quito’s Historical City Centre Colonial plazas, buildings and churches display a fascinating mixture of Spanish and indigenous styles. The city was the first place in the world to be designated an UNESCO World Heritage Site in 1978.

Teleférico Take this aerial cableway up on the Pichincha Volcano hillside to enjoy “Quito from the sky.” At 4100m you will be able to enjoy views over Quito, and on a clear day, you will also have views of the Cotopaxi and the Cayambe volcanoes. Enjoy a cup of coca tea to keep you warm.
